DEW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2017 in Review

34 of the 4,409 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in WisdomTree Global High Dividend Fund (DEW) for Q4 2017, worth a combined $44.3M — up 13% from $39.1M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 10 funds opened new DEW positions and 4 closed out — a net gain of 6 holders — while 10 added to existing stakes and 6 trimmed.

The largest buyer was StrategIQ Financial Group, opening a new position worth an estimated $2.82M. The largest seller was Thrivent Financial for Lutherans, exiting entirely with an estimated $5.55M sold.
